Transaction e44a13279444f6ac51d21b26f391db4840f9a16e317b592896bce4d24ea9fb85
1 Input
1 Output
-
e44a13279444f6ac51d21b26f391db4840f9a16e317b592896bce4d24ea9fb85:0
- value
- 6654341
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ab39fd26a027991a2cc8d6e48e6882769a91bff OP_EQUALVERIFY OP_CHECKSIG
- address
- 17ozBiEY1B5aTE1xgueMj19buoU7KXJidF